No bulls for Cerrone

October 25, 2012 by Jason Cruz Leave a Comment

MMA Junkie reports on Donald Cerrone and his inability to participate in bull-riding due to his current contract with the UFC.  The contract clause reflects the need for the UFC to protect their fighters and its investment. Rousey to UFC?

October 25, 2012 by Jason Cruz 2 Comments

MMA Fighting reports on Dana White’s interview with Sports Illustrated on Tuesday where he indicated that women’s MMA will be heading to the UFC.  The reason for the move is due to Strikeforce Women’s Champ Ronda Rousey. Canada to host 5 events, TUF in 2013

October 22, 2012 by Jason Cruz 6 Comments

MMA Mania reports that the UFC will have 5 events in Canada next year and likely a TUF series.  The announcement should capitalize on the massive fan output from fans to the north.
